Transaction 12558a79dfd5cf26869bacb621bf626cccba52d99c9651367c555ab8f4316731
1 Input
1 Output
-
12558a79dfd5cf26869bacb621bf626cccba52d99c9651367c555ab8f4316731:0
- value
- 1599111
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 986ed949ab06ff9f4714c7b6421b74c9eafd6e2c OP_EQUAL
- address
- 3Fb1RcMAUmJPKzBJ4cbVsF64t2Da5S9pCr